The OM1005 Ethernet switch has four 10/100/1000BASE-T electrical ports and one optical SFP port. The SFP port supports a variety of wavelengths, optical speeds, and fiber types depending on which SFP module is ordered. Since both 100BASE-X and 1000BASE-X
optics are supported, the optical network may be upgraded to a higher speed at a later time. The SFP type (multimode, singlemode, or bidirectional single fiber) is specified at the
time of ordering, and can be seen on the label on the base of the unit (see Ordering
Information). A signal strength bar graph shows the received optical power. The Ethernet and power connectors are on the front for easy access. A rear dip switch enables manual or auto configuration. The power input accepts 5 to 30 VDC input from an external power cube (supplied). A secondary power supply connection is available on the rear of the case.
Fiber Reach: 1000BASE-SX multimode fiber 550 m; 1000BASE-LX singlemode fiber 10 km
Data Rate: 10/100/1000 Mbps Electrical, 100/1000 Mbps Optical

The OM1001-AUI has one optical port and one Ethernet AUI (MAU) port. It connects a legacy ethernet device with an AUI (DTE) port to a 1000BASE-X network device.
The OM1001E converter translates 10/100/1000BASE-T signals to 1000BASE-X optical. It has one optical and one RJ-45 twisted pair port. Auto negotiation and MDI/MDI-X crossover provide plug and play operation, or the operation mode may be set with switches. The OM1001E has an extended input voltage range for 5, 12 or 24V operation. The OM1001E supersedes the OM1001.
The OM1000 converter translates 1000BASE-T to 1000BASE-X. It has one optical and one RJ-45 twisted pair port. Two OM1000 converters can be connected back to back to interconnect a pair of local area networks. Auto negotiation, limited to 1000 Mbps, and auto MDI/MDI-X crossover provide plug and play operation. Jumbo frames are supported.
The OM1000P media converter has one optical and one electrical port. It connects a 1000BASE-T Ethernet device to a 1000BASE-X fiber optic Local Area Network over a pair of optical fibers. The OM1000P can supply 48 Volts to attached equipment for PoE applications.
The OM102P media converter has one optical and one RJ-45 twisted pair port. It translates 100BASE-TX to 100BASE-FX. The OM102P can supply 48 Volts to attached 802.3af equipment for Power over Ethernet (PoE) applications. A legacy mode is available to support IP phones predating the 802.3af standard. Auto negotiation, limited to 100 Mbps, and auto MDI/MDI-X crossover provide plug and play operation. Jumbo frames are supported.
The OM102 converter has one optical and two RJ-45 twisted pair ports. It translates 10BASE-T/100BASE-TX to 100BASE-FX. The OM102 can supply 48 Volts to attached 802.3af equipment for Power over Ethernet (PoE) applications. Auto negotiation and MDI/MDI-X crossover provide plug and play operation.
Two Ethernet LANs can be bridged over a serial link by using two OM100Ses. The OM100S converts
Ethernet packets to and from serial data.
For longer distances the serial port can connect to a synchronous serial modem such as a CSU/DSU. The OM100S is sometimes used with a secure terminal for data encryption. The serial interface is switch selectable as EIA-530/A, V.35, or RS-232.
The OM101 converter has one optical and one RJ-45 twisted pair port. It translates 10BASE-T/100BASE-TX to 100BASE-FX. Auto negotiation and MDI/MDI-X crossover provide plug and play operation. Two OM101’s can be connected back-to-back to interconnect networks. The OM101 is available with ST or SC connectors, and for singlemode or multimode fiber.
The OM101PD is a 802.3af powered device which receives its power from the RJ-45 twisted pair port. This eliminates the need for a power cube. It's intended for use with switch and router products that source 48 Volts according to the 802.3af specification. It translates 10BASE-T/100BASE-TX to 100BASE-FX. Auto negotiation and MDI/MDI-X crossover provide plug and play operation.
The OM101-AUI has one optical port and one Ethernet AUI (MAU) port. It connects a legacy ethernet device with an AUI (DTE) port to a 100BASE-FX network device.
The OM100 media converter has one optical and one RJ-45 twisted pair port. It translates 100BASE-TX to 100BASE-FX. A switch flips the Tx and Rx pairs which eliminates the need for
crossover cables. The OM100 is available with ST or SC connectors, and for singlemode or multimode fiber. Jumbo frames are supported.

OMC1E
100BASE-FX or OC3 Singlemode to Multimode Fiber Converter
The OMC1E converts an optical singlemode fiber signal to an optical multimode fiber signal. It is often used in 100BASE-FX systems to transition from singlemode fiber to multimode fiber; however, it works equally well with SONET OC3 or other optical signals with data rates under 155 Mbps. The OMC1E supersedes the OMC1, and is a direct replacement that has an extended voltage input range of +4.5V to +32VDC.
